中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

如何在React中實現對話框的無障礙訪問

發布時間:2024-06-17 10:45:49 來源:億速云 閱讀:84 作者:小樊 欄目:web開發

要在React中實現對話框的無障礙訪問,您可以遵循以下幾個步驟:

  1. 使用適當的語義標記:確保對話框使用適當的語義標記,例如使用<div role="dialog">元素來表示對話框。

  2. 設置適當的ARIA屬性:為了幫助屏幕閱讀器用戶理解對話框的目的和功能,您可以為對話框添加適當的ARIA屬性,例如aria-labelledby用于指定對話框的標題,aria-describedby用于指定對話框的描述信息等。

  3. 管理焦點:確保對話框打開時,焦點被移動到對話框內的第一個可操作元素上,并且在用戶關閉對話框時,焦點被恢復到打開對話框之前的位置。

  4. 提供鍵盤導航支持:確保用戶可以使用鍵盤導航來瀏覽對話框內的各個元素,例如使用Tab鍵在可操作元素之間進行切換,使用Enter鍵執行操作等。

  5. 提供適當的反饋:為了幫助所有用戶理解對話框的狀態和操作結果,您可以通過屏幕閱讀器或其他方式提供適當的反饋,例如通過提示消息或狀態更新等。

通過遵循以上步驟,您可以確保對話框在React應用程序中具有良好的無障礙訪問性能,使得所有用戶都能夠方便地使用對話框功能。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

九寨沟县| 临沧市| 绿春县| 惠来县| 清水县| 达州市| 偃师市| 娄烦县| 兰州市| 方城县| 盘山县| 禄丰县| 鄂尔多斯市| 南充市| 壶关县| 宜都市| 黄大仙区| 通化县| 婺源县| 新营市| 桦川县| 岑溪市| 张家界市| 玉龙| 阳原县| 镇坪县| 江北区| 兰考县| 广东省| 邹城市| 济宁市| 万荣县| 曲周县| 元谋县| 呼玛县| 彭水| 阳谷县| 忻州市| 亳州市| 宜兰县| 瑞昌市|